Transaction 76fc20e34accadf660b82a5241fbebf196e43ebe5dfa9a5924f3b0bd7b317d5a
1 Input
2 Outputs
- 76fc20e34accadf660b82a5241fbebf196e43ebe5dfa9a5924f3b0bd7b317d5a:0
- 76fc20e34accadf660b82a5241fbebf196e43ebe5dfa9a5924f3b0bd7b317d5a:1
value 2055866
address 3EaYSPyAKjwQQmRbX4Mw3TAJQKyMQTzLx9
value 8739027
address 1AgUCD6p1vEimUWufLmMGGdzucWLVWSH1W